The Pros and Cons of Qantas Premier Titanium
While the Qantas Premier Titanium offers an array of benefits, it is essential to weigh these against the costs.
Pros
-
High Points Earn Rate
Earn quickly with uncapped points on all spending categories.
-
Exclusive Lounge Access
Access to Qantas lounges can make travel more comfortable.
-
Comprehensive Travel Insurance
Robust insurance offers peace of mind.
-
Concierge Service
Personal assistance for bookings adds extra convenience.
Pros
-
High Annual Fee
The annual fee of $1,200 may be steep for some.
-
Additional Cardholder Costs
There is an extra $100 fee for each additional cardholder.
-
Higher Interest Rates
Interest rates are premium at 20.99%.
-
International Transaction Fees
Travel spending abroad may incur additional fees.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the annual fee?
The annual fee is $1,200, with an additional $100 fee for each extra cardholder.
What are the interest rates on this card?
The card features a 20.99% p.a. variable purchase rate and 21.99% p.a. variable cash advance rate.
What insurance covers are included?
Includes overseas travel insurance, and insurance for flight inconvenience, transport accidents, and global hire car excess.
How does lounge access work?
You receive four complimentary lounge invitations per year, including Qantas Club lounges.
